Title: MacBooks finally see upgrade to Kaby Lake
Post by: Redaktion on June 06, 2017, 04:30:41
Apple has updated their MacBook and MacBook Pro lines of notebooks with Kaby Lake CPUs, optional 16GB of RAM for all models, and improved dedicated graphics for the 15-inch MacBook Pro. The base model MacBook Pro 13 also saw a price-drop to US$1299.
